The Beatles Story is home to one of the North West’s best kept secrets - an authentic re-creation of Mathew Street in 1960’s Liverpool, including a replica of the original Cavern Club. Our exhibition is available to hire privately between 6pm and 12pm, all week, where your guests can enjoy a wide range of themed live entertainment, food and beverage options, ranging from a relaxed informal party to a fully-inclusive private dining event.
